6 Nov 2017, 4:09 pm by INFORRM
While there has not been a great deal of case-law on the application of section 9 to date, the early signs are that courts will apply it strictly: see Ahuja and the very recent (brief and obiter) analysis of section 9 by Nicklin J in Huda v Wells and ors [2017] EWHC 2553 (QB) at [84]-[85].
